Job description

This role is for one of the Weekday's clients

Min Experience: 8+ years

Location: Remote (India)
JobType: full-time

We are looking for a Senior WordPress Developer with 8+ years of hands-on experience in custom WordPress development. The ideal candidate should be capable of independently developing and maintaining custom themes and plugins, managing production WordPress environments, and delivering responsive, secure, and high-performance websites.

Requirements

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ain custom WordPress themes and plugins.
  • Independently manage live/production WordPress environments.
  • Take ownership of WordPress architecture, technical decisions, performance, and security.
  • Convert UI designs, layouts, and wireframes into responsive WordPress websites.
  • Work with PHP, WordPress Core, HTML5, CSS3, JavaScript, jQuery, and MySQL.
  • Debug and resolve issues using browser developer tools such as Chrome Inspector.
  • Ensure cross-browser and cross-device compatibility.
  • Collaborate with designers, backend teams, and stakeholders to deliver projects on time.
  • Use Git and standard version-control practices.

Required:

  • 8+ years of hands-on WordPress development experience.
  • Strong PHP and WordPress Core knowledge.
  • Strong experience with custom WordPress themes and plugins.
  • Experience independently managing production WordPress systems.
  • Good knowledge of HTML5, CSS3, JavaScript, jQuery, and MySQL.
  • Experience with Elementor and/or WPBakery.
  • Exposure to AWS or cloud environments.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and ability to work independently.

Good to Have:

  • Experience with healthcare, hospital, pharma, or clinical websites.
  • Experience with WordPress multisite or multilingual implementations.
  • Knowledge of PostgreSQL.
  • Experience with performance optimization, caching, and WordPress security.
  • Experience working in Agile/Scrum environments.
